Interesting Facts about 1,5-Dibromo-2,3-dimethyl-benzene
1,5-Dibromo-2,3-dimethyl-benzene, also known as a member of the brominated and substituted benzene family, is a fascinating compound in the realm of organic chemistry. Here are some engaging insights:
- Structural Complexity: This compound features a benzene ring with both bromine and methyl substitutions, leading to its unique chemical behavior. The arrangement of substituents impacts its reactivity and chemical properties significantly.
- Applications: Compounds like 1,5-dibromo-2,3-dimethyl-benzene are often utilized in organic synthesis, serving as intermediates in the development of complex molecules. The bromine substituents can engage in various reactions, enabling the preparation of numerous derivatives.
- Environmental Considerations: Being a brominated compound, its use raises environmental concerns. Certain brominated substances are known to persist in the environment and can be potentially harmful. Understanding its degradation and toxicity is essential for chemical safety.
- Historical Significance: The exploration of substituted benzene derivatives dates back to the 19th century. Their study has paved the way for modern organic chemistry and materials science.
- Reactivity: The presence of bromine atoms often enriches the compound's electrophilic reactivity, making it an interesting subject for chemists aiming to understand substitution reactions in aromatic compounds.
